Jim Chapman Lake/Cooper Dam Stilling Basin/Outlet Area to Close Temporarily

May 3, 2023- U.S. Army Corp of Engineers officials with the Fort Worth District, announced today that starting May 8, the Stilling Basin/Outlet Area at Jim Chapman Lake will be closed temporarily for repaving of the parking lot. For the safety of the public and work crews, the Stilling Basin/Outlet Area will be closed for approximately 30 to 45 days for fishing and all recreation activities.
